8.15.0 Release
New Functionality
Request for Alternative workflow
Based on feedback, we have amended the Request for Alternative workflow. In version 8.15.0, the General Contractor creates and issues the Request for Alternative. Once issued, the Prime Consultant is alerted and is able to Close the Request for Alternative.

General Contractor RFI Report
- Age (Days) is calculated as the difference between the current date and the date the RFI was Submitted on.
- Response Time (Days) is calculated as the difference between the date the RFI Closed on and Submitted on Date.

Request for Information
A text box, called Short Description, is available for the General Contractor to store details of the RFI for reporting purposes only. Text entered into this area is limited to a maximum of 200 characters.
CRX Standard Report
CRX dollar values will populate on the CRX Standard Report when the CRX is in Submitted or Closed status only.

Tasks
Task Types, found in Tasks and Meeting items, are now sorting by
- Project
- Meeting Type
- Sort Order
- Title
As such, all Project specific Task Types will be grouped together and all Global (across all project) Task Types will be grouped together, displaying in the format of:
Item Title [Meeting Type] [Project or Global]

Performance Report
Identified Issue: “Summary By Office” Average Submittal calculation was including “As Builts” and “O & M Manual” Submittal types. Since “As Builts” and “O & M Manual” Submittal types are not included in the Submittal Average Response Time calculations, these should not be included in the “Summary By Office” Average Submittal calculation.
